WebThe California Gold Rush Before Gold Was Discovered: Prior to the gold discovery in 1848, California was not a state. The land belonged to Mexico. However, the Mexican government had very little involvement in the area as it was so far north. California was fairly isolated as it was difficult to travel there from the United States and Europe. WebThe Gold Rush included explorers who didn't actually mine for gold. The American writer Samuel Clemens wrote about the Gold Rush for the San Francisco Call newspaper. Bankers Henry Wells and William Fargo provided economic security to miners.
